Slang for the new $100 bill. The blue refers to the blue 3-D security ribbon on the front of the bill.
*Look for a blue ribbon on the front of the note. Tilt the note back and forth while focusing on the blue ribbon. You will see the bells change to 100s as they move. When you tilt the note back and forth, the bells and 100s move side to side. If you tilt it side to side, they move up and down. The ribbon is woven into the paper, not printed on it.

The paper band that wraps a 100 stack of 100's. Hunnid Band is 100 * 100 = $10,000.
Hunnid is just 100.
